Understanding the Importance of Safety in Yacht Charters
The Core of Safety Protocols
Safety is the cornerstone of any successful yacht charter. While yachts provide a sense of freedom and luxury, they are also vessels exposed to the unpredictability of the sea. Understanding the importance of safety can prevent accidents and ensure that guests can fully relax and enjoy the experience.
Charter companies that prioritize safety invest in:
- Comprehensive crew training: Experienced crews know how to respond to emergencies such as man-overboard situations, medical incidents, or fire hazards.
- Regular equipment checks: Life-saving devices, fire extinguishers, communication systems, and navigation equipment must be in perfect working order.
- Pre-departure safety briefings: Every guest must know how to operate emergency equipment and understand safety procedures.
A charter company's safety record reflects its commitment to client well-being. Researching the company's reputation and certifications before booking can save stress and potential danger at sea.
Pre-Charter Preparations: Planning for Safety
Before stepping aboard, there are several safety steps that guests and operators should take. These preparations include:
Detailed Itinerary and Weather Planning
A well-planned itinerary reduces exposure to hazards. Understanding local waters, currents, tides, and marine traffic is crucial. Weather conditions should be closely monitored to avoid storms or unsafe sailing conditions. Flexibility in scheduling is essential; changing plans to avoid rough seas is a sign of a responsible charter.
Health and Fitness Checks
Guests should consider their personal health when planning a yacht trip. Seasickness, mobility limitations, or chronic conditions require proactive measures, such as carrying medications, wearing motion sickness bands, or requesting additional crew assistance.
Safety Gear Preparation
Ensure that personal items include:
- Life jackets suitable for your size and weight
- Non-slip footwear
- Sun protection (hats, sunscreen, UV-protective clothing)
- First aid kits and emergency contact numbers
A responsible charter company will also provide extra safety gear for children, elderly passengers, and guests with specific needs.
Onboard Safety Procedures
Safety Briefings: What You Need to Know
Once onboard, guests should attend a comprehensive safety briefing. This usually includes:
- Location and use of life jackets and flotation devices
- Fire safety procedures and extinguisher locations
- Emergency exits and assembly points
- Man-overboard drills and emergency signaling
- Communication protocols for contacting the crew or external help
Understanding these protocols is crucial; even a short briefing can make a significant difference during emergencies.
Navigational Safety
Navigational safety ensures the yacht avoids collisions, shallow waters, and restricted zones. Modern yachts are equipped with GPS systems, radar, and AIS (Automatic Identification Systems) that help track nearby vessels. However, vigilance is always essential. Captains must communicate with coastal authorities, and guests should follow crew instructions regarding movement on deck during night navigation or rough seas.
Fire Safety
Fire onboard is a serious risk. Common causes include galley mishaps, electrical faults, and improper handling of flammable materials. Safety measures include:
- Fire extinguishers in multiple accessible locations
- Smoke detectors in cabins and common areas
- Fire-resistant materials used in yacht interiors
- Crew trained in fire-fighting techniques
Guests should never tamper with fire safety equipment and must report any irregularities immediately.
Man-Overboard Procedures
A man-overboard incident requires immediate response. Crew members are trained to:
- Deploy flotation devices immediately
- Alert the captain and sound alarms
- Initiate coordinated retrieval maneuvers
Guests should familiarize themselves with the procedures and always wear life jackets when instructed, particularly during adverse weather or nighttime operations.

Comprehensive Safety Measures for Specific Scenarios
Nighttime Sailing
Night sailing increases the risk of collisions and requires:
- Adequate deck lighting
- GPS and radar monitoring
- Crew vigilance on watch shifts
- Guests avoiding movement on deck unless escorted
High Seas and Storm Conditions
If a sudden storm arises:
- Guests must stay below deck
- All hatches and doors should be secured
- Loose objects must be stowed to prevent injury
- Crew will navigate to calmer waters or seek shelter
Understanding these procedures beforehand makes everyone onboard more confident and reduces panic.
Alcohol Consumption and Safety
Moderate alcohol consumption is acceptable, but overindulgence can compromise balance, judgment, and reaction times. Some yachts have strict policies, and guests should comply to ensure personal safety and that of others.

Crew Training and Certification
Crew qualifications significantly impact safety:
- Captains should hold international yachting certifications and local licenses
- Crew members must be trained in first aid, firefighting, and navigation
- Ongoing drills and refresher courses keep skills sharp
When booking a charter, ask about crew certifications and training history.
